Bouquet of flowers in a vase Circle of Jean-Baptiste Belin de Fontenay (1653-1715). Oil on canvas.
Belin studied under Jean-Baptiste Monnoyer (1636-1699), eventually marrying his daughter and
succeeding him as a flower painter at the Gobelins tapestry workshop. This education and exposure
working with tapestry, informed many a fine flower painting Belin produced.
In our painting, a rich arrangement of flowers, including tulips, roses and smaller white blossoms can be appreciated. Jewel- like in quality, each flower is rendered with precision. The painting is composed with a sense of restraint, balance and order synonymous with 17th century French school painting.
